Transaction 717885319d751152743091b7c72b965cffb91432b068700263051217820da3e1
1 Input
2 Outputs
- 717885319d751152743091b7c72b965cffb91432b068700263051217820da3e1:0
- 717885319d751152743091b7c72b965cffb91432b068700263051217820da3e1:1
value 5000
address n2NYdafNQf1L9gwR38ZzuHuKeY4QFz3p78
value 41748932218
address miEurGiqRjyEzeaFPZBg97bxabHFrVdkBW